Home about IT Motivation Course Sales Project About Me

Saturday, March 06, 2010

selection formula Dtpicker at VB - CrystalReport

from CrystalReport : Any dates that are being passed to Crystal Reports must be in Crystal Reports Date format, Date(yyyy,mm,dd).

MsSQL server and Crstal report, have diffrent format data.
so please use this one:

Private Sub Command1_Click()
CrystalReport1.Connect = "ODBC;driver=SQLSERVER;" & "UID=sa;pwd=password;server=server_name;DATABASE=database_name"
CrystalReport1.ReportFileName = App.Path & "\REPORT\report111.rpt"
Qry = "{Transaksi.Tanggal} >= " & Format(DTPicker1, "\Date(yyyy,mm,dd)") & " " _
& "And {Transaksi.Tanggal} <= " & Format(DTPicker2, "\Date(yyyy,mm,dd)")
CrystalReport1.SelectionFormula = Qry
CrystalReport1.RetrieveDataFiles
CrystalReport1.WindowState = crptMaximized
CrystalReport1.Action = 1
End Sub

1 comment:

D'NATURAL SURABAYA said...

thx alot buat info nya tp & " " _

buat apa ya? kenapa harus dipisah dengan ""